> > I am trying to perform densitometry measurements according to this
> > method:
> >
> > "The nucleus was encircled by free-hand drawing of a border around the
> > outermost mRNA-expressing cells in the nucleus. The mean density and the
> > area of the selection were measured. The mean density of the background
> > was measured from a rectangular area of corresponding size in the
> > immediate vicinity of the nucleus. The mean density of the background
> > was subtracted from the mean density of the nucleus and..."
> >
> > Now, the problem is I can't specify a ROI of the same area of the place
> > I measured previously. I tried taking the square root of the area (given
> > in um^2) and specifying a square ROI with sides of this length but the
> > resulting area measured is always smaller!
> >
> > Is it possible to specify a square ROI by inputing an area value in
> > square micrometers?
